发明名称 Reception and transmission power gains control in a point-to-multipoint system
摘要 A point-to-multipoint radiocommunication network comprises master stations and subscriber slave stations, each master controls a pool of slaves generally fixed at different distances from the master, some user terminals can be connect at each slave by wire/cable/fibre optic. The master acquires and stores the main configuration and operational parameters of the slaves, in particular the distances from the master. Both the master and the slaves include transmission and reception AGC circuitry suitable to counteract fast-varying unforeseeable multipath fading (Rayleigh) and rain fading and a larger but calculable free-space attenuation due to the spread of the distances. Unforeseeable fading need fast-dynamic AGCs while calculable attenuation need semistatic AGCs. The master is continuously monitoring the access channels in uplink in order to detect the access requests from the slaves. As soon as the slave station is switched on to have access to the network, the master will start those operation usually named "registration" or "ranging" or "sign-on". Up to this point the slave station is able to decode the downstream signal and to set a rough value of the upstream transmission level, but the receiving and transmitting semistatic gain/attenuation levels are not correctly configured to make the dynamic range properly counteract all the possible fading phenomena. When the master station receives a signal transmitted by the slave station, it transmits a distance information to the remote slave station; the distance may be retrieved from an installation database or calculated during the registration phase or at the initial transmissions of the slave station, according to different possible embodiments. The slave station uses the distance information to automatically configure the "semistatic" gain/attenuation level in the best way. The same concepts apply to the point-to-point radio relay systems (fig.4). <IMAGE>
